An airfoil comprises an airfoil body with an internal cavity and inner and outer covers. The airfoil body defines a first major surface of the airfoil, and a rib extends along the internal cavity. The inner cover is bonded to the airfoil body over the internal cavity, and includes a coupling element extending along the internal cavity in cooperative engagement with the rib. The outer cover is bonded to the airfoil body over the inner cover, and defines a second major surface of the airfoil.

An airfoil comprising: an airfoil body comprising: a first side;a second side opposite of the first side;a first internal cavity extending into the first side;a second internal cavity extending into the first side; anda first rib extending along and between the first internal cavity and the second internal cavity;an outer cover extending over the first internal cavity, the first rib, and the second internal cavity; andan inner cover bonded to the outer cover and the body, the inner cover comprising a first coupling element extending along the first internal cavity in cooperative engagement with the first rib;wherein the inner cover extends into the first internal cavity and away from the outer cover in a first portion;wherein the inner cover extends over the first rib and adjacent to the outer cover in a second portion; andwherein the inner cover extends into the second internal cavity and away from the outer cover in a third portion;and wherein the inner cover further comprises a corrugated stiffener spaced from the first rib along the first internal cavity. 2. The airfoil of claim 1, further comprising adhesive for bonding the inner cover to the airfoil body and for bonding the outer cover to the inner cover. 3. The airfoil of claim 2, wherein the coupling element provides shear stress relief for the adhesive during operation of the airfoil. 4. The airfoil of claim 1, wherein the airfoil body defines a first major surface of the airfoil and the outer cover defines a second major surface of the airfoil. 5. The airfoil of claim 1, wherein the airfoil body further comprises: a third internal cavity extending into the first side; anda second rib extending along and between the second internal cavity and the third internal cavity;wherein the outer cover extends over the third internal cavity and the second rib. 6. The airfoil of claim 5, wherein the inner cover further comprises: a second coupling element extending along the second internal cavity in cooperative engagement with the second rib. 7. The airfoil of claim 1, wherein the first coupling element comprises a side section extending transversely to the outer cover and a lateral section extending along the outer cover, the side section in cooperative engagement with the first rib. 8. The airfoil of claim 1, wherein the first coupling element comprises a retainer forming a mechanical coupling in cooperative engagement with an inwardly tapered side of the first rib. 9. The airfoil of claim 1, wherein the airfoil body defines a concave surface of the airfoil and the outer cover defines a convex surface of the airfoil. 10. A blade comprising: an airfoil body comprising: a first side;a second side opposite of the first side;a first internal cavity extending into the first side, the first internal cavity having a first internal surface;a second internal cavity extending into the first side, the second internal cavity having a second internal surface; anda first rib extending along and between the first internal cavity and the second internal cavity;an outer cover extending over the first internal cavity, the first rib, and the second internal cavity;an inner cover bonded to the outer cover and the body, the inner cover including a first corrugated structure in cooperative engagement with the first rib;a first void between the outer cover and the inner cover; anda second void between the inner cover and the first internal surface. 11. The blade of claim 10, wherein the first corrugated structure provides shear stress relief for an adhesive between the outer cover and the inner cover during operation of the blade. 12. The blade of claim 11, wherein the inner cover further comprises: a corrugated stiffener spaced from the first rib along the first internal cavity. 13. The blade of claim 10, wherein the first corrugated structure comprises a side section extending transversely to the outer cover and a lateral section extending along the outer cover, the side section in cooperative engagement with the first rib. 14. The blade of claim 10, wherein the airfoil body further comprises: a third internal cavity extending into the first side; anda second rib extending along and between the second internal cavity and the third internal cavity;wherein the outer cover extends over the third internal cavity and the second rib. 15. A rotor blade comprising: a forging defined along a first major surface of the rotor blade;ribs formed in the forging, the ribs defining an internal cavity therebetween;an inner cover adhered to the forging over the internal cavity, the inner cover being a sheet having retention elements extending along the internal cavities in mechanical engagement with the ribs wherein the inner cover enters and exits the internal cavity and occupies only a portion of the internal cavity; andan outer cover adhered to the forging over the inner cover, the outer cover defining a second major surface of the rotor blade, opposite the first major surface of the rotor blade. 16. The rotor blade of claim 15, wherein the retention elements comprise corrugated structures having side sections extending transversely to the inner cover in mechanical engagement with corresponding sides of the ribs. 17. The rotor blade of claim 15, wherein the retention elements comprise hook or catch features mechanically coupled to the ribs. 18. The rotor blade of claim 15, wherein the inner cover comprises corrugated stiffening features spaced from the ribs along the internal cavities. 19. The rotor blade of claim 15, wherein the inner cover comprises stiffeners having side surfaces transverse to the inner cover, the side surfaces spaced from the ribs along the internal cavity.
